A mythological sage from ancient India. The Sanskrit word Vyasa originally meant editor, and it is unclear to what extent it refers to a specific individual, but it generally refers to Beda Vyasa, the editor of the Vedas. Badarayana, the editor of the epic poem Mahabharata and the Puranas (ancient tales), the founder of the Vedanta school, and the author of the Brahma Sutra, is also identified with Vyasa. However, this was probably done to increase the authority of the work.
